Historical Roots of Classic Slot Machines
Since the advent of the first mechanical slot machines in the late 19th century, the game’s fundamental appeal has been rooted in simplicity and chance. Developed by innovators like Charles Fey, whose Liberty Bell in 1895 is widely regarded as the first true slot machine, these early gambling devices relied solely on luck, with minimal rules. This purity of randomness and straightforwardness laid the groundwork for a mass-market entertainment form that quickly infiltrated casinos and, eventually, private parlors.

Transition to the Digital Realm and Impact on Gaming Experiences
As technology advanced, so did the slot machine experience. The 1960s introduced electromechanical slots, culminating in the emergence of fully digital games in the 1970s and 80s. The transition to online platforms during the 1990s further expanded accessibility, allowing players to experience familiar mechanics from the comfort of their homes.
